Gunshots were fired on a busy block in Tamarac in broad daylight Wednesday afternoon, authorities said.
At around 11:27 a.m., Broward Sheriff’s Office Tamarac District deputies responded to a shots fired call near the 8000 block of Northwest 78th Street,
Once on scene, deputies learned that an altercation between two adult males had escalated and that shots were fired, according to BSO.
Deputies made contact with the man who opened fire, officials said. It was not immediately clear whether he was arrested.
The other man involved in the altercation drove himself to a local hospital with injuries listed as not life-threatening, officials said. BSO officials did not say whether the man had been shot.
BSO Violent Crimes detectives were investigating this incident Wednesday, according to the agency.
Additional information about the shooting was not made public.
